Finding Key Pieces for Each Season
Each season has its must-have pieces that serve as the foundation of any great outfit. In spring, focus on light fabrics like cotton and linen, and embrace pastel colors and floral patterns. Summer calls for breathable materials such as chiffon and lightweight denim, with bold colors and prints making a statement. For fall, incorporate rich textures like suede and leather, and opt for earthy tones and plaids. Winter is all about warmth and comfort, so invest in high-quality wool coats, cashmere sweaters, and thermal leggings. These key pieces will ensure you have a versatile wardrobe that can be easily adapted as the seasons change.
Accessorizing to Enhance Your Look
Accessories are the finishing touches that elevate any outfit from ordinary to extraordinary. In spring, consider adding a statement necklace or a colorful scarf to complement your look. Summer is the perfect time to experiment with hats and sunglasses, providing both style and protection from the sun. During fall, opt for chunky knit scarves and stylish belts to add depth to your outfits. In winter, don't shy away from bold gloves and elegant jewelry to bring a touch of glamour to your layered ensembles. By carefully selecting your accessories, you can effortlessly enhance your look and express your personal style.
Layering Techniques for Changing Weather
Mastering the art of layering is crucial for navigating the transitional periods between seasons. Start with a base layer made of breathable fabrics to keep you comfortable throughout the day. In spring, layer with light cardigans or denim jackets that can be easily removed as temperatures rise. For fall, consider layering shirts with vests or lightweight jackets that offer warmth without bulk. In winter, layering becomes essential; start with thermal tops and add sweaters, cardigans, and coats as needed. Experiment with different textures and lengths to create visually interesting combinations that are both functional and fashionable.
